Emergent organization and polarization due to active fluctuations

Benoît Mahault, Prakhar Godara, Ramin Golestanian

2023Physical Review Research10 citationsDOIOpen Access PDF

Abstract

A general model of self-propulsion with active fluctuations is introduced. It is shown that such a nonequilibrium noise source qualitatively modifies the organization of self-propelled particles in activity landscapes, as well as their collective dynamics in the presence of quorum-sensing interactions.
